A significant 1.1 billion euros in solidarity contributions and training compensation was distributed to clubs globally between July 2011 and June 2023. These figures highlight the substantial financial flows involved in player transfers beyond the direct buying and selling clubs.
The majority of this impressive sum, approximately 880 million euros, originated from international transfers. This indicates that a significant portion of the global football economy involves players moving between different national associations. Domestic transfers, while also contributing, accounted for a smaller share of these payments.
Training compensation represented the larger slice of these solidarity payments, amounting to 619 million euros. This mechanism is designed to reward clubs that invest in developing young players through their academies and youth systems. It acknowledges the resources and effort put into shaping future talent.
Solidarity contributions, on the other hand, made up 481 million euros of the total. This system ensures that a percentage of a transfer fee for a player is distributed to clubs that participated in their training and education from the age of 12 to 23. This helps support grassroots football and smaller clubs who might not otherwise directly benefit from a player’s later high-profile moves.
This comprehensive distribution demonstrates the interconnectedness of the global football transfer market. It underscores the financial recognition given to clubs at all levels for their role in player development and career progression.

Football’s Future: A Focus on the Next Generation
The world of football is constantly evolving, and a major aspect of this evolution is the development of young talent. Clubs and national federations alike are placing increasing emphasis on nurturing the next generation of players, recognizing them as the bedrock of future successes. This commitment extends beyond mere on-field performance, encompassing holistic development for athletes.
Investment in youth academies is at an all-time high. These institutions are not just training grounds; they are designed to be comprehensive educational environments. Aspiring footballers receive top-tier coaching, often from former professional players who bring invaluable experience. Alongside rigorous technical and tactical training, young athletes are also supported in their academic pursuits, ensuring a well-rounded development that prepares them for life both within and outside of football.
The focus on youth development also involves sophisticated scouting networks. These networks span the globe, identifying promising young players often from humble beginnings. The goal is to unearth raw talent and provide them with the resources and opportunities they need to flourish. This proactive approach ensures a continuous pipeline of talent, safeguarding the sport’s future at all levels.
Ultimately, the emphasis on youth development underscores a long-term vision for football. It’s about building sustainable success, fostering a new wave of passionate fans, and ensuring the beautiful game continues to thrive for decades to come. By investing in its youngest participants, football is investing in itself.

Football’s New Offside Law: A Detailed Explanation
Football will see a significant alteration to its offside rule, set to be introduced for the 2024-25 season. The International Football Association Board (IFAB), football’s law-making body, has approved this change, which aims to reduce controversies and offer clearer interpretations. The alteration largely redefines the concept of “deliberate play” by an opposing player, a key factor in offside decisions.
Under the new law, a player in an offside position will be considered onside if they receive the ball after an opponent deliberately plays it. This applies even if the opponent’s deliberate play was unsuccessful or misguided. The key distinction lies in the opponent’s intentional act of touching the ball. This removes the grey area where a defender’s mistake or deflection might have previously been interpreted as not playing the ball deliberately, thus keeping the attacking player offside.
IFAB’s primary motivation behind this amendment is to simplify the decision-making process for officials and VAR. Historically, the interpretation of “deliberate play” has been a source of much debate and inconsistent application. By clearly stating that any deliberate touch by a defender makes an attacking player onside, regardless of the quality of that touch, the new rule seeks to bring more clarity and reduce the frequency of contentious offside calls.
This change is expected to have a noticeable impact on how attacking and defending teams approach the game. It could potentially encourage more risk-taking passes from defenders, knowing that a miskick might no longer instantly lead to an offside call for the attacker. Conversely, attacking players might be more inclined to linger in advanced positions, anticipating a deliberate but errant play from an opponent. The football world awaits its implementation to observe these anticipated effects on the beautiful game.
